EVERYONE should have an updated anti-virus program with the most recent definition file. The anti-virus program must be configured to screen downloaded email and attachments. Without an updated anti-virus program, a new HTML embedded virus, W32/BadTrans@MM, could possibly infect your computer without your knowledge just by downloading an email message, particularly if Microsoft email programs are being used.
